14. What is the length of a diagonal of rectangle EFGH? Show your work

Answer:

The length of the diagonal of the rectangle is of \sqrt{58} units.

Step-by-step explanation:

Pythagorean theorem:

The square of the hypothenuse h is equal to the sum of the squares of sides a and b, that is:

h^2 = a^2 + b^2

Diagonal of a rectangle:

The diagonal is the hypothenuse, while the sides are a and b.

In this question:

The height has coordinates are y = 9 and y = 12, so the height is a = 12 - 9 = 3

The length has coordinates at x = -6, x = -13, so the length is b = -6 - (-13) = 7

Diagonal:

d^2 = a^2 + b^2

d^2 = 3^2 + 7^2

d^2 = 9 + 49

d^2 = 58

d = \sqrt{58}

The length of the diagonal of the rectangle is of \sqrt{58} units.

This is a question on my partial fractions homework, but no matter what I try I can't figure it out..
Ierofanga [76]
\dfrac{x^2+x+1}{(x+1)^2(x+2)}=\dfrac{a_1x+a_0}{(x+1)^2}+\dfrac b{x+2}
\implies\dfrac{x^2+x+1}{(x+1)^2(x+2)}=\dfrac{(a_1x+a_0)(x+2)+b(x+1)^2}{(x+1)^2(x+2)}
\implies x^2+x+1=(a_1+b)x^2+(2a_1+a_0+2b)x+(2a_0+b)
\implies\begin{cases}a_1+b=1\\2a_1+a_0+2b=1\\2a_0+b=1\end{cases}\implies a_1=-2,a_0=-1,b=3

So you have

\displaystyle\int_0^2\frac{x^2+x+1}{(x+1)^2(x+2)}\,\mathrm dx=-2\int_0^2\frac x{(x+1)^2}\,\mathrm dx-\int_0^2\frac{\mathrm dx}{(x+1)^2}+3\int_0^2\frac{\mathrm dx}{x+2}
=\displaystyle-2\int_1^3\dfrac{x-1}{x^2}\,\mathrm dx-\int_0^2\frac{\mathrm dx}{(x+1)^2}+3\int_0^2\frac{\mathrm dx}{x+2}

where in the first integral we substitute x\mapsto x+1.

=\displaystyle-2\int_1^3\left(\frac1x-\frac1{x^2}\right)\,\mathrm dx-\frac1{1+x}\bigg|_{x=0}^{x=2}+3\ln|x+2|\bigg|_{x=0}^{x=2}
=-2\left(\ln|x|+\dfrac1x\right)\bigg|_{x=1}^{x=3}-\dfrac23+3(\ln4-\ln2)
=-2\left(\ln3+\dfrac13-1\right)-\dfrac23+3\ln2
=\dfrac23+\ln\dfrac89
